Something Went Wrong. There was a problem parsing the JSON result?

Hi there, First, let me congrat everybody on this forum... I just heard about Buzztouch few days ago, and I already have the impression that all this is very nice. The thing is I'm having troubles with my self hosted control panel. 1. There are no plugins installed. How can I retrieve the original ones? 2. I can't see my apps (the ones developed in the original control panel). 3. I can't build a simple test project ( it keeps giving the notice: "Something Went Wrong. There was a problem parsing the JSON result?", even though the JSON validation went ok. All that stuff about API seems to be configured... What could be wrong? Thanks, Pedro

Hello! You can get plugins from your account page on this site. Click th link on the top right of this screen (if you're logged in). On the left hand side of your account page is a 'plugins' link. Click on that and you'll see all the currently available plugins. Click on the ones you want and you'll see "download package" underneath the share icons. Download to your PC. You can either ftp those to the plugins folder on your self hosted server or upload them via your admin panel. Go to the admin area of your self hosted server and see the "manage plugins" link on the left hand side. Install/Upload/Refresh plugins on that screen. You won't see the apps from your original control panel, you're starting afresh. Get an app set up with some plugins and see if you continue to get any JSON errors.

Hi ceerup, My first post here for you. The problem for me was that my shared hosting server did not have allow_url_fopen enabled. My hosting company won't change the setup so I had to create a php.ini file with just one line in it:- allow_url_fopen = On I put this file in bt_v15/bt_app and now my source code downloads fine. I hope this helps. Mark
